What is a Bedside Cot?
A bedside cot, likewise called a co-sleeper or side sleeper, is a type of crib that is developed to attach safely to the side of the moms and dad's bed. It allows for easy access to the baby during the night while supplying a different sleeping space. This design supports safe sleep practices while assisting in nighttime feeding and reassuring.

Considerations When Choosing a Bedside Cot
When purchasing a bedside cot, it is important to think about numerous factors:
1. Security Standards
Guarantee that the [Cot With Drawers Underneath](https://kanban.xsitepool.tu-freiberg.de/0Rtd85fvTnOXuWy_ZWFa7g/) adheres to regional safety regulations. Try to find brands that have been checked and licensed for security.
2. Bed mattress Quality
The quality of the bed mattress is vital for the health and comfort of the baby. A firm, encouraging mattress is needed to avoid concerns such as SIDS (Sudden Infant Death Syndrome).
3. Budget
Bedside cots come in a variety of costs. Set a budget and consider the finest value for the features you need.
4. Size and Space
Ensure to inspect the dimensions of the [Cot Beds With Drawer](https://telegra.ph/15-Gifts-For-The-Cot-With-Drawers-Lover-In-Your-Life-12-01) and guarantee that it fits well beside your bed. If space is a concern, choose a model that is quickly portable or foldable.
5. Relieve of Assembly
Some cots are more made complex to assemble than others. Try to find models that are user-friendly, particularly if you expect moving the cot more than once.

Are bedside cots safe for newborns?
Yes, bedside cots are designed to offer a safe sleeping environment for newborns, provided they fulfill security standards and are set up correctly.
2. At what age can my baby transition from a bedside cot?
Typically, babies can use bedside cots till they have to do with 6-12 months old or up until they can pull themselves up or roll over. Always describe the manufacturer's standards.
3. Can bedside cots be utilized for taking a trip?
Numerous bedside cots are portable and foldable, making them appropriate for travel. Nevertheless, ensure that the specific model you pick is designed for easy transportation.
4. How do I guarantee the bedside cot is protected to my bed?
Follow the producer's guidelines carefully for attaching the cot to your bed. Many designs have systems to secure them tightly.
